The length and breadth of a rectangle are both prime numbers, and its perimeter is 40 cm. Then the maximum possible area of the rectangle (in $$\text{cm}^2$$) is
Correct Answer: 91
Half the perimeter is $$\frac{40}{2} = 20$$ cm, so the length and the breadth are two primes adding up to 20. The possible prime pairs are 3 and 17, giving an area of $$3 \times 17 = 51$$, and 7 and 13, giving an area of $$7 \times 13 = 91$$. The greater of the two is $$91\ \text{cm}^2$$.
